November 8-12, 2010
National Evolutionary Synthesis Center
Raleigh-Durham, NC, USA
NESCent has funds to support a certain number of hackathons every year. We are holding a GMOD hackathon November 2010. It focuses on improving GMOD's support for evolutionary biology.
The Hackathon Proposal was submitted to NESCent in early June 2010, and approved shortly thereafter.
Event Dates
November 8-12, 2010
Timeline
- June 3, 2010
- funding application submitted to Nescent
- June 10, 2010
- funding application approved
- July 6, 2010
- participant applications open
- September 1, 2010
- participant application deadline
